What is AI Route Optimization?

At its core, AI route optimization uses intelligent algorithms to determine the most efficient sequence of stops for your service vehicles. It considers factors like traffic, distance, and appointment windows. This goes beyond simple GPS mapping.

It's about finding the best way to get your crews to all their jobs. Think of it as a super-smart assistant planning your entire day, or even week, for multiple teams. This is where AI dispatch software for lawn service truly shines.

How to Implement AI Route Optimization

Getting started is simpler than you might think. It primarily involves choosing the right software and integrating it into your workflow. This is where GPS routing for landscaping businesses becomes essential.

Step 1: Assess Your Needs

Before looking at software, understand your current challenges.

  • How many crews do you have?
  • What is your typical service area?
  • What are your busiest times of year?
  • Do you have specific client service windows?

This assessment will help you identify features most critical for your business.

Step 2: Research Software Options

There are several players in the AI route optimization market. Let's compare a few.

  • Route4Me: A well-established platform known for its comprehensive features. It offers a user-friendly interface and robust route planning capabilities. Route4Me is often praised for its flexibility.

  • OptimoRoute: Another strong contender focusing on dynamic route planning and optimization. It handles complex constraints and offers excellent real-time adjustments.

  • WorkWave Route Manager: This software is designed specifically for field service businesses. It integrates scheduling, routing, and driver management.

[!IMPORTANT] When comparing, look for features like real-time traffic updates, driver tracking, and proof of delivery. These are vital for effective GPS routing for landscaping businesses.

Step 3: Choose and Integrate Your Software

Based on your needs and research, select the best route planning software landscapers find valuable. Most offer free trials. Use these to test how well they work for your specific operations.

The integration process usually involves uploading your client list and job details. You'll then configure service times, crew availability, and any special instructions. This is how you automate lawn care routes.

Step 4: Train Your Team

Your crews need to understand how to use the new system. Most modern software has mobile apps for drivers. Ensure they know how to access their routes, update job status, and use navigation features.

Effective training minimizes disruption and maximizes adoption. This is key for successful AI dispatch software for lawn service.

Step 5: Monitor and Refine

Once implemented, don't just set it and forget it. Monitor the results.

  • Are routes consistently efficient?
  • Are fuel costs decreasing?
  • Are customers happier with service times?

Use the data provided by the software to make adjustments. This iterative process ensures you continuously benefit from AI route optimization for lawn care.

Common Challenges and Solutions

  • Resistance to Change: Some team members might be hesitant. Emphasize how the software makes their jobs easier, not harder. Highlight time savings and reduced stress.

  • Data Accuracy: The software relies on accurate client addresses and service details. Implement a process for verifying this information.

  • Dynamic Changes: Unexpected issues like traffic jams or client cancellations can occur. Good AI route optimization software allows for real-time re-optimization.
